To insert a table, place the cursor where you want the table to be

Choose Table, Insert, Table from the drop down menu

In the dialog box, choose the number of columns and rows you want to appear in the table

Choose AutoFit to contents and click OK

To insert an image, place your cursor where you want the image to appear.

Choose Insert, Picture, From File and select the image you want to use.

Your image may appear too big. Don’t worry, you can resize it.

Resize by dragging the double arrow that appears when you move the cursor over the picture handles on any of the four corners.

To make a PowerPoint presentation choose Create a New Presentation.

The first slide appears with the Title. Under it, you may write your name.

To insert a new slide, choose Insert, New Slide.

To format the slide (or insert a new slide with a different layout) choose Format, Slide Layout and choose the format you want.

To preview your presentation, click on the preview icon in the lower left-hand corner. It looks like a projection screen.

While viewing the preview, click the Space Key or Down Arrow on the keyboard to view the next slide.
